Appendix 20 Legal Opinion on Exclusive
Representation October 5, 1987 Mr. R. W. Godwin, General Chairman Brotherhood of Locomotive Engineers 97 South Buffalo Road Hamburg, New Jersey 14075 Dear Sir: During the negotiations which concluded in the collective bargaining agreement effective July 1, 1985, the parties engaged in extensive discussions regarding the legality of an exclusive representation provision, such as the clause contained in the current agreement between the United Transportation Union (T) and NJTROI. After review and consultation, we have advised our client, NJTROI, that such a provision would likely be deemed unlawful under the Railway Labor Act, 45 U.S.C. S152 Eleventh (a), and therefore unenforceable. Very Truly Yours, Grotta, Glassman & Hoffman, P.A. Original Signed by: Desmond Massey Appendix 21 Understanding on Air Conditioning on
Engines/MUs May 18, 1990 D. T. Abbott General Chairman, Brotherhood of Locomotive Engineers 201 Avenue "I" Matamoras, PA 18336 File: L-141-BLE Dear Mr. Abbott: This letter sets forth our mutual understanding between the Brotherhood of Locomotive Engineers (BLE) and NJ TRANSIT Rail Operations, Inc. (NJTROI) concerning the dispatch and operation of engines equipped with an air conditioned engine control compartment or compartments. As discussed, NJTROI will, at its sole discretion, acquire through purchase, rental or lease, new, used, remanufactured or rebuilt diesel-electric, electric or any other engine equipped with air conditioned engine control compartment or compartments. The same option will extend to engines currently rostered by NJTROI that are modified, rebuilt or remanufactured either by the Carrier or its agents. It is also understood that NJTROI will make a good faith effort to maintain engine control compartment air conditioners in proper working order, however, the dispatch of an engine equipped with an engine control compartment air conditioner that is non-functioning or the failure of an air conditioning unit while an engine so equipped is in transit will not constitute grounds for Engineers working under the provisions of the Collective Bargaining Agreement to refuse to operate said engine.
